1. The development of RFID tags

The development of RFID tags has probably gone through the following stages:

1. Initial period (1940s-1970s): RFID technology originated during World War II and was initially used for military purposes. 1948, engineer Léon Theremin invented the world's first passive RFID device, marking the initial technical development of RFID.

 

2. Development period (1980s-1990s): In the early 1980s, the push for ISO standards led to the standardization of RFID technology. In the 1990s, RFID technology was gradually applied to the business sector, especially playing a key role in supply chain and logistics management.

 

3. Maturity (2000s-2010s): Over time, the cost of manufacturing RFID tags has gradually decreased, making the technology more economical and practical. Since the 2000s, RFID technology has been widely used in retail, manufacturing and logistics.

 

Innovation period (after 2020): In the last few years, RFID technology has been integrated with new technologies such as the Internet of Things and Artificial Intelligence to continuously improve and innovate.

 

2. How RFID tags work

RFID tags usually operate at 13.56MHz, but there are also RFID tags in other frequency bands, such as 433MHz, 915MHz, and so on. It does not need a built-in power supply, but gets its energy by receiving radio waves sent by the reader. When the reader sends a signal of a specific frequency to the tag, the circuitry inside the tag is activated and sends the information stored in the tag back to the reader. This process is like a conversation between two people, where one sends out a sound and the other hears it and responds. There is no need for physical contact between the reader and the tag, only in the range of electromagnetic waves can be communicated.

 

3. Application areas of RFID tags

RFID tags are used in a wide range of applications and permeate almost every aspect of our lives.



1. Retail industry: used for inventory management, anti-theft and settlement, improving inventory management efficiency and realizing self-service checkout.

2. Logistics industry: Improve the efficiency of logistics, real-time tracking of the location and status of goods, for intelligent warehouse management.

3. Medical industry: to manage patient identity, medical records and drug information, to improve the quality of medical services, for medical device management.

4. Transportation industry: used for automatic vehicle charging, parking lot management, and improving the efficiency of traffic management.

5. Livestock industry: through the implantation of RFID tags in livestock, to check the health status of animals at any time and improve production efficiency.

6. Library: RFID tags embedded in books to easily realize self-service borrowing and inventory management, and improve the efficiency of library operations. Utilizing RFID technology to establish an automatic book return system to simplify the return process.

7. RFID technology is used in guest room access control system to provide more secure and convenient access control. Tag attached to the luggage, you can always track the location of luggage to reduce the risk of loss

8. Smart home: RFID tags are applied to household goods to realize the tracking and intelligent management of goods.

9. Intelligent access control system: RFID technology can be used for home access control system to provide a safer home environment.
